Summary
SEBI has issued a prohibitory order under Recovery Certificate No. 6461 of 2023 against nine individuals - Lakhani Babulal Hansraj, Ramanlal Ravchand Shah, Bhagavatiben Vishnubhai Patel, Dhirajbhai Baladevji Thakor, Vinod Solanki, Jasmin Indu Shah, Mahendrabhai Naranbhai Patel, Pinesh Nareshkumar Shah, and Bharti Sharma - in connection with the matter of BFL Asset Finvest Ltd (formerly known as BFL Developers Ltd). This order is part of SEBI’s enforcement and recovery proceedings.
